WORKERS UNITED LOCAL 50, founded in 2004, is a community nonprofit that reported $3.0M in total revenue in fiscal year 2023. Revenue grew 9% year-over-year, indicating healthy expansion. Expenses of $2.8M left a modest 6% surplus.
